How to Approach Mobile Conversion Optimization Budget Planning for Mobile-Apps
- Allocate budget first to advanced analytics platforms that offer real-time cohort analysis, funnel visualization, and anomaly detection.
- Reserve funds for controlled A/B and multivariate testing environments; experimentation is the best evidence for effective changes.
- Invest in user feedback tools like Zigpoll alongside others (Qualtrics, Typeform) to validate hypotheses directly with users.
- Prioritize budget for iterative quick-win tactics before scaling; bootstrapped growth tactics reduce risks and enable fast learning.
- Allocate part of budget to integrating behavioral and telemetry data to uncover subtle friction points missed by traditional metrics.
A 2024 Forrester report found that companies combining quantitative data with qualitative feedback achieve 30% higher conversion lift, demonstrating the value of balanced budget allocation across analytics and user insights.
Step 1: Deep Dive into Behavioral Analytics and Funnel Data
- Use analytics platforms tailored for mobile apps that track user journey at each funnel stage.
- Identify micro-conversions (e.g., add-to-cart, tutorial completion) and drop-off points.
- Prioritize areas with highest volume and highest drop-off impact on revenue.
- Use event-level data and user segmentation to understand behavioral nuances.
Example: A mobile-game app team reduced onboarding drop-off from 40% to 22% by reallocating budget to funnel analytics and testing onboarding flow variants.
Step 2: Build and Scale Experimentation Frameworks Thoughtfully
- Start with lightweight A/B testing tools integrated directly into the app.
- Gradually invest in more complex multivariate and personalized experiment platforms as scale grows.
- Store experiment metadata centrally for cross-team insights.
- Avoid over-testing too many hypotheses at once; focus on high-impact changes.
Limitation: Some smaller teams may find the overhead of full experimentation frameworks costly initially; bootstrapped tactics like guerilla testing or internal user panels can supplement.
Step 3: Incorporate User Feedback Mechanisms Early
- Deploy in-app surveys using Zigpoll to capture real-time user sentiment tied to conversion steps.
- Complement behavioral data with qualitative insights to verify reasons behind friction.
- Use short, targeted questions to avoid survey fatigue.
- Combine feedback with session replay tools for context.
One mobile commerce app used Zigpoll to discover usability issues in checkout, boosting conversion by 15% after addressing them.
Step 4: Prioritize Bootstrapped Growth Tactics That Require Low Spend
- Focus on rapid iteration of UI/UX changes visible to user segments with high conversion potential.
- Use feature flagging to roll out changes incrementally and measure impact.
- Optimize app performance metrics (load times, responsiveness) monitored via analytics.
- Leverage push notifications and personalized messaging as low-cost nudges to increase conversions.
Example: A startup app increased paid subscriptions 3x in 6 months by implementing segmentation-informed messaging campaigns with minimal additional infrastructure investment.
Step 5: Establish Metrics and Monitoring to Know If It's Working
- Track core KPIs: conversion rate per funnel stage, user lifetime value, retention tied to acquisition channels.
- Monitor experiment results with statistical rigor to avoid false positives.
- Use dashboards that blend raw metrics with qualitative feedback summaries.
- Regularly revisit budget allocations based on data-driven insights and ROI of various tactics.

mobile conversion optimization metrics that matter for mobile-apps?
| Metric | Importance |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Funnel Conversion Rate | Core indicator | Break down by acquisition channel and cohort |
| Drop-off Rate by Step | Pinpoints friction | Use behavioral analytics for granularity |
| Retention Rate | Indicates long-term value | Cohort analysis over 7, 30, 90 days |
| Average Revenue Per User | Links conversion to revenue | Include in experiments to track monetization impact |
| Load Time & App Performance | UX impacts conversion directly | Track via telemetry and synthetic monitoring |
| Survey Response Trends | Qualitative sentiment | Use tools like Zigpoll to identify emerging concerns |
